How to remove snow from rooftop photovoltaic panels

How to remove snow from rooftop photovoltaic panels

To keep your solar panels snow-free, you've got several effective options. You can use a roof rake to gently pull snow off, or employ a leaf blower for light, powdery snow. . Do I need to remove snow from my solar panels? And if so, what's the easiest way to do it? The short answer: In most cases, you don't need to do anything at all. How much does it cost to sample and inspect photovoltaic panels

How much does it cost to sample and inspect photovoltaic panels

On average, a solar panel inspection costs $200, with most homeowners paying between $150 to $350. These inspections help prevent efficiency loss and catch issues early, saving you money in the. . Costs depend on system size, inspection type, and your region's labor rates. Roof-mounted or hard-to-reach panels increase costs. What Does a Solar Panel Inspection Involve?
